Once you've selected your trip, motorcycle upkeep ideas turn into your ally for longevity and basic safety. Standard motorbike upkeep isn't really nearly fixing problems; It really is preventive care that retains you rolling hassle-no cost. Get started with each day pre-journey checks: inspect tires for use and suitable inflation, generally 28-36 PSI front and 32-forty two PSI rear determined by load. Take a look at brakes for responsiveness and guarantee lights, horn, and signals work flawlessly. Chain-pushed bikes need weekly interest—clean and lube the chain to circumvent stretching or snapping beneath anxiety.

Bike assistance guidelines extend to every month routines for deeper inspections. Change engine oil each three,000-5,000 miles working with producer-proposed synthetic blends to shield in opposition to warmth and dress in. Inspect air filters; filthy ones starve the motor of energy and hike gas use. Spark plugs should be checked per year or each ten,000 miles—fouled plugs lead to misfires and very poor starts off. Battery terminals corrode quickly in humid climates, so clean up them with baking soda Answer and implement dielectric grease. For air-cooled engines common in cruisers, check fin cleanliness to stay away from overheating.

Seasonal motorcycle upkeep recommendations are crucial, especially in variable climate. Winter season storage? Major off gasoline with stabilizer, disconnect the battery, and elevate tires off the ground. Spring revival requires clean fluids and an entire diagnostic scan for Digital bikes. Suspension forks have to have grease each 20,000 miles to maintain easy damping—leaky seals spell disaster on bumpy roads. Brake fluid absorbs moisture with time, so flush it every single two yrs to circumvent spongy stops.

Over and above Fundamental principles, Sophisticated motorbike servicing strategies target functionality tweaks. Valve clearances will need examining every 12,000-24,000 miles; tight valves trigger electricity reduction and valve burn off. Up grade to braided brake traces for sharper reaction about inventory rubber hoses. Tire rotation just about every five,000 miles evens don, extending everyday living to ten,000+ miles. Gas-injected bikes take pleasure in throttle system syncs to equilibrium cylinders for smoother revs.

Bike bicycle kinds influence maintenance priorities. High-revving Activity bikes guzzle additional oil less than observe abuse, demanding Repeated alterations. Cruisers with belt drives skip chain lube but demand tension checks. Off-highway Filth bikes in dual-Activity courses crave Regular fork oil swaps as a result of impacts. Electric major ranked motorcycles simplify everyday living—no oil, chains, or valves—but battery wellbeing monitoring via applications prevents untimely degradation.

Security weaves through each individual factor. Worn chains snap unpredictably, so change at 0.five-1% extend. Loose spokes on journey wheels result in failures mid-path—tighten weekly using a spoke wrench.
